About Smallbone
Smallbone is a company based in London (United Kingdom) founded in 1979 was acquired by Lux Group Holdings in June 2018.. Smallbone offers products and services including Bespoke Kitchens, Whole House Furniture, and Kitchen Collections. Smallbone operates in a competitive market with competitors including Charlotte James Furniture, Clive Christian Furniture, Halo Living, Eat Sleep Live and Hyperion Furniture, among others.

Frequently Asked Questions about Smallbone
When was Smallbone founded?
Smallbone was founded in 1979 and raised its 1st funding round 6 years after it was founded.
Where is Smallbone located?
Smallbone is headquartered in London, United Kingdom. It is registered at London, England, United Kingdom.
Who is the current CEO of Smallbone?
Leo Caplan is the current CEO of Smallbone.
What is the annual revenue of Smallbone?
Annual revenue of Smallbone is $27.37M as on Dec 31, 2021.
What does Smallbone do?
Smallbone was established in 1979 in London, United Kingdom, as a manufacturer in the luxury home furniture sector. Operations focus on the production of high-end furnishings for residential spaces. The company is led by Leo Caplan, who serves as Owner, CEO, and Chairman. Activities are centered in the UK, with distribution handled through the domain smallbone.co.uk.
